Mastering Font Pairing for Editorial Depth
A common mistake in web design and editorial design is using a display font for body copy. While Golden Bloom is stunning for titles, callouts, and logo marks, it is best reserved for short text where its unique character can shine. To create a balanced layout, you need effective font pairing.
For a modern, clean look, pair Golden Bloom with a neutral, low-contrast sans serif font for your captions and body text. This keeps the focus on the headline while ensuring long-form readability. Alternatively, for a more sophisticated, magazine-style aesthetic, combine it with a classic serif font. The contrast between the tall, rounded sans serif and the traditional serif creates a dynamic tension that feels high-end and curated. This approach works exceptionally well for blog headers, white papers, or branded templates where you want to establish thought leadership.
